Abstract
The utility model discloses a quick coupling scaffold steel pipe, including the steel pipe body, two supports are installed to the symmetry on the steel pipe body, and the distance between two supports is greater than the diameter of steel pipe body, still be provided with the bolt on the steel pipe body, set up on the support with the pin rod assorted pinhole of bolt, when two steel pipe body cross connection, two steel pipe bodies are named respectively to first steel pipe body and second steel pipe body, in the pin rod of the bolt of first steel pipe body inserted the pinhole on the support of second steel pipe body, the pin rod of the bolt of second steel pipe body also inserted in the pinhole on the support of first steel pipe body, this quick coupling scaffold steel pipe has changed the mode that traditional scaffold steel tubes clamps connects, need not to use the bolt, and with the predetermine mounted position of support beading at the steel pipe, the bolt operation has been avoided twisting for a long time in the installation and dismantlement efficiency that have improved the scaffold greatly.

Background technology
Scaffold refers to that job site is the various supports that operative also solves vertically and horizontal transport is set up.Scaffold the most frequently used is in the market fastener type steel pipe scaffold, and fastener type steel pipe scaffold has easy to maintenance, long service life and the multiple advantage such as input cost is low.Fastener type steel pipe scaffold adopts fastener to connect with the junction being horizontally set with steel pipe erecting steel pipe.By the steel tube scaffold clasp that GB15831-2006 is manufactured by malleable cast iron or cast steel, reinforced by bolted on connection.In actual use, workman need take a long time tight a bolt or unclamp bolt, installs and dismounting trouble, uses duration.Scaffold is generally arranged on outdoor architecture building site in addition, and the bolt thread of fastener is easily collided with, get rusty or by concrete parcel destruction, affect the fastness of scaffold.And the fastening force of standpipe fastener depends on frictional force, and frictional force is determined the degree of tightening of bolt by workman, if do not tighten, frictional force is too small, then standpipe fastener easily skids, and there is potential safety hazard, if be threaded through head, then easily occurs the situation of bolt fracture.Therefore be fastened by bolts the scaffold of installation, not only installation effectiveness is low, and poor reliability.

Detailed description of the invention
Below in conjunction with the accompanying drawing in the utility model embodiment, be clearly and completely described the technical scheme in the utility model embodiment, obviously, described embodiment is only the utility model part embodiment, instead of whole embodiments.Based on the embodiment in the utility model, those of ordinary skill in the art are not making the every other embodiment obtained under creative work prerequisite, all belong to the scope of the utility model protection.
Refer to Fig. 1 ~ 2, in the utility model embodiment, a kind of quick-jointing scaffolding steel pipe, comprise steel pipe body 3, described steel pipe body 3 is symmetrically installed with two bearings 1, and the distance between two bearings 1 is greater than the diameter of steel pipe body 3, bearing 1 is positioned at the installed position of steel pipe body 3, this installation site is for installing another steel pipe arranged in a crossed manner with this steel pipe body 3, preferably, described bearing 1 is weldingly fixed on steel pipe body 3, distance between two bearings 1 is slightly larger than the diameter of steel pipe body 3, in an assembling process, the steel pipe body 3 erected is intersected with the steel pipe body 3 be horizontally set with and combines, and the body of the steel pipe body 3 be horizontally set with embeds between two bearings 1 of the steel pipe body 3 erected, the steel pipe body 3 be horizontally set with directly is pressed on the bearing 1 of the steel pipe body 3 erected, rely on normal pressure load-bearing, reliable and stable, break away in non-stress direction to prevent two steel pipe bodies 3, described steel pipe body 3 is also provided with latch 2, bearing 1 offers the pin-and-hole matched with the pin rod of latch 2, when two steel pipe body 3 interconnections, two steel pipe bodies 3 called after first steel pipe body and the second steel pipe body respectively, the pin rod of the latch 2 of the first steel pipe body inserts in the pin-and-hole on the bearing 1 of the second steel pipe body, the pin rod of the latch 2 of the second steel pipe body also inserts in the pin-and-hole on the bearing 1 of the first steel pipe body, to prevent from breakking away, described latch 2 is weldingly fixed on steel pipe body 3, the quantity of latch 2 is identical with the quantity of base 1.
Operating principle of the present utility model is: described quick-jointing scaffolding steel pipe, when the assembling carrying out erecting steel pipe and be horizontally set with between steel pipe, the steel pipe body 3 erected is intersected with the steel pipe body 3 be horizontally set with and combines, and the body of the steel pipe body 3 be horizontally set with embeds between two bearings 1 of the steel pipe body 3 erected, the steel pipe body 3 be horizontally set with directly is pressed on the bearing 1 of the steel pipe body 3 erected, rely on normal pressure load-bearing, reliable and stable, the body of the steel pipe body 3 erected also embeds between two bearings 1 of the steel pipe body 3 be horizontally set with, and makes both stable connections.Inserted by the pin rod of the latch 2 of the steel pipe body 3 erected in the pin-and-hole on the bearing 1 of the steel pipe body 3 be horizontally set with, the pin rod of the latch 2 of the steel pipe body 3 be horizontally set with also inserts in the pin-and-hole on the bearing 1 of the steel pipe body 3 erected.Thus the steel pipe body 3 erected is assembled complete with the steel pipe body 3 be horizontally set with.When needing dismounting, only need to extract lock bolt bar, can by steel pipe body 3 separately.
Described quick-jointing scaffolding steel pipe changes the mode that traditional scaffold steel pipe fastener connects, without the need to using bolt, bearing is directly welded on the default installation site of steel pipe, substantially increase the installation and removal efficiency of scaffold, avoid long-time stubborn bolt operation, be horizontally set with steel pipe in addition to be directly pressed in and to erect on the bearing of steel pipe, instead of rely on frictional force fastening, therefore connect more reliable.
